Item 2.01 Completion of Acquisition or Disposition of Assets.
On January 2, 2014, Salix Pharmaceuticals, Ltd. (the “Company”) filed a Current Report on Form 8-K reporting, among other things, that it had completed its acquisition of Santarus, Inc. (“Santarus”), in accordance with the terms of the Agreement and Plan of Merger, dated November 7, 2013, among the Company, Willow Acquisition Sub Corporation, an indirect wholly owned subsidiary of the Company, and Santarus. The Company paid aggregate consideration of approximately $2.6 billion in connection with its acquisition of Santarus.
The Company is filing this Amendment No. 1 to its Current Report on Form 8-K dated January 2, 2014, in order to provide the financial statements required by Item 9.01 to Form 8-K with respect to the acquisition of Santarus.
